Buff Orpington

Buff Orpington Chickens are known for being an extremely gentle, friendly and docile bird that enjoys being held and follow their owners closely. Coupled with their ability to be dual-purpose, it is no wonder that they are such a popular breed. Egg production starts between 20and 24 weeks (5 to 6 months), which is typical of most breeds, but they can certainly start laying a few weeks early. You can expect 4+ large pinkish brown eggs a week. In their first year they can produce 200-280 eggs with proper diet and care. These birds are known for being disease resistant, but they are especially known for being cold-hardy. A lesser-known fact is that they are also heat tolerant.
